I’m joining Shout’s campaign to Move for Mental Health.

This Mental Health Awareness Week, people around the UK will be moving for their mental health, all while fundraising for Shout - the UK’s only free, confidential, 24/7 text messaging support service for anyone struggling to cope.

As a Shout volunteer, I've seen first-hand the difficulties people using the service are facing on a daily basis - and therefore how important the service is. That's why I've decided to fundraise to help keep the service free and accessible to anyone who needs it.

As someone who is typically inactive, I'm aiming to walk 70,000 steps during Mental Health Awareness Week - that's more than double my average of 30,000 steps per week - while raising funds to support Shout's vital services.

By donating to my fundraising page, you’ll be supporting the thousands of children, young people and adults who text Shout every day with issues including suicidal thoughts, anxiety, depression, abuse, bullying and self-harm.
